# Data Stores: Keyturn Rotation Utility

Keyturn rotates service credentials nightly and records rotation history in its own ledger database, separate from the app stores it manages. Release managers should verify the ledger is reachable before approving a rotation window, since a failed write leaves credentials half-rotated. The ledger runs on the Ostermere cluster and is reached via the connection string below.

replica DSN, fahif-bagag: cockroachdb://casok_svc:V7@db-3280.zemvarsoft.example:5432/briion

**Ticket BREW-1142: Config drift between Stonemill sandboxes and plugin CI**

Plugin builds passing locally but failing in the hermetic Stonemill sandbox. Root cause: several authors still read host env vars; hermetic mode strips them. This was flagged in the migration notes — host state is not available, period. Fix: declare all inputs in your plugin manifest. Do not work around the sandbox. We will reject plugins that probe the host. For reference, every sandbox is instantiated with exactly the following configuration.

settings of fawip-fawip:
[ralvan]
team = ulays
access_code = ac_9b2051
owner = norys.feniel
host = ralvan.torvatech.corp
port = 9200
peer = druix.olvarqsoft.internal
salt = 2ff5e71f
pin = 1386

### Step 4 — Carve out the user module

Okay, this is the fun part. Once Brindlewick's monolith is running behind the new gateway, the user module gets its own process and its own env file. Copy users.env from the template, set the database host to the new Petrel cluster, and double-check the session timeout. Right after the timeout line, add the signing secret on its own line.

vault entry, yahif-yajep: COURIER_KEY29=b802bdf8034096b65a51c6ba5abe2